Sausage Balls Recipe

Description

Sausage Balls are a savory, bite-sized appetizer made with ground pork sausage, cheddar cheese, baking mix, and cream cheese. Perfect for parties or game day snacks, they are baked until golden and cooked through, offering a delightful blend of cheesy, meaty flavors in every bite.


Ingredients

Scale

Main Ingredients

  • 1 pound ground pork sausage (mild or hot)
  • 2 cups shredded cheddar cheese (8 ounces)
  • 2 cups all-purpose baking mix (like Bisquick)
  • 1 (8-ounce) block cream cheese


Instructions

  1. Preheat Oven: Preheat your oven to 400°F. Prepare two sheet pans by lining them with parchment paper or aluminum foil. If using foil, lightly spray with nonstick cooking spray to prevent sticking.
  2. Mix Ingredients: In a large bowl, use a mixer to blend the cream cheese and sausage until combined. Add the baking mix and mix well. Then add the shredded cheddar cheese and mix just until everything is incorporated.
  3. Form Balls: Portion out about 1 tablespoon of the dough and roll each portion into a 1-inch ball. A #50 scoop works well for this. Place the formed balls evenly across the prepared sheet pans.
  4. Bake: Bake the sausage balls for 15 minutes or until they are lightly browned and cooked through. The internal temperature should reach 165°F to ensure they are safely cooked.

Notes

  • Use mild or hot sausage depending on your spice preference.
  • Ensure the cream cheese is softened for easier mixing.
  • Use parchment paper for easy cleanup and to prevent sticking without added spray.
  • If you don’t have a scoop, use a tablespoon measure to portion the dough evenly.
  • Check internal temperature with a meat thermometer to guarantee food safety.
  • These sausage balls can be served warm or at room temperature.
  • Leftovers can be refrigerated and reheated in the oven for best texture.
